Family dynamics

"Family dynamics" as a category for books encompasses narratives that delve into the intricate and multifaceted relationships within families. These stories often explore the emotional, psychological, and social interactions among family members, highlighting themes such as love, conflict, loyalty, and betrayal. They may examine the impact of generational differences, cultural backgrounds, and life events on family cohesion and individual identity. Whether through the lens of drama, comedy, or tragedy, books in this genre provide a deep and often poignant look at how families navigate the complexities of life together, offering readers insights into their own familial experiences and relationships.

  8. 983. A Place Apart by Paula Fox

    In this poignant coming-of-age novel, a young girl named Victoria grapples with the complexities of adolescence after the death of her father. As she and her mother move to a new town, Victoria finds herself feeling isolated and disconnected from her peers. Her journey of self-discovery is marked by her struggle to find her place in a world that seems indifferent to her pain. Through introspection and the forging of new relationships, she learns to navigate the challenges of growing up and the importance of understanding and empathy in overcoming personal grief.
